Fall For The Book 2022 Welcomes Author Amor Towles
The author of "The Lincoln Highway" will headline the spring Pop-Up Lit Night Series.
Press release from Fall for the Book:
Nov. 20, 2021
New York Times-bestselling novelist Amor Towles, author of A Gentleman in Moscow, will headline Fall for the Book’s 2022 Spring Pop-Up Lit Night Series with an in-person appearance at the Sherwood Center in Fairfax, VA on April 21, 2022 at 7:30 p.m. Towles will be speaking about his gripping new novel, The Lincoln Highway, set in 1950s America, which spans ten days of misadventure and self-discovery. Told from multiple points of view, it follows a juvenile delinquent recently released from detention to his home in rural Nebraska only to be taken on a fateful journey to New York City. The New York Times Book Review calls it “wise and wildly entertaining . . . permeated with light, wit, youth.”

This event, sponsored by the Fairfax County Public Library, will be free to the public, with pre-registration required. Fall for the Book will release free tickets in the spring. More information can be found at fallforthebook.org.
